Emma's Electrical Services
by
Rosemary Cescolini
and
Amanda Cescolini
Emma the Electrician answers a call from a family whose blow dryer has suddenly stopped working . . . and there is smoke coming from it! After Emma rushes over to help, she investigates to find out what happened and how she can fix it. Naomi is fascinated with Emma and her work as an electrician. Eager to learn, Naomi decides to tag along with Emma to understand what an electrician does and how Emma is going to solve their electrical problem. Naomi asks Emma a lot of questions and even lends a hand with the repair! Come along with Naomi as she learns about this exciting and helpful trade and how trailblazing women like Emma are breaking barriers and making a difference in their communities.
Rosemary Cescolini and Amanda Cescolini have collaborated on Emma’s Electrical Services, to introduce young girls to alternative career opportunities in the skilled trades. Noticing the severe shortages of people entering careers in the trades, Rosemary and Amanda are bringing awareness to the many possibilities and opportunities that exist within the various trades. Rosemary, once a high school teacher, former master artisan in woodworking, is currently enjoying personal and professional success as a business owner of Royal Door & Trim Supplies Ltd. Amanda works in the educational field and encourages girls to explore skilled trades as viable career options, as they are no longer male-dominated professions. Rosemary and Amanda, who live in Vaughan, Ontario, with their partners, are dedicated to coaching and mentoring young women to succeed in both their personal and professional lives. They are active members of several organizations, including The Board of Education, Only Women Entrepreneurs, GWOAT™ = Greatest Woman of All Time, Women in Business, and the Canadian Manufacturers and Exporters Association, which support their mission to empower women.
